Cómo generar dinámicamente algo en lugar de otra cosa en React
En un componente React JSX puedes decidir dinámicamente generar algún componente u otro, o solo una parte de JSX, en función de condicionales.
La forma más común es probablemente el operador ternario:
const Pet = (props) = { return ( {props.isDog ? Dog / : Cat /} )}
Otra forma, que funciona muy bien cuando conceptualmente tienes un if
pero no un else
es usar el operador, que funciona de esta manera: si la expresión anterior se evalúa como verdadera, imprime la expresión posterior:
const Pet = (props) = { return ( {props.isDog Dog /} {props.isCat Cat /} )}
Tal vez te puede interesar:
- Introducción a React
- Agregar evento de clic a los elementos DOM devueltos desde querySelectorAll
- Cómo cambiar el valor de un nodo DOM
- Cómo comprobar si un elemento DOM tiene una clase
Representación condicional en React
En un componente React JSX puedes decidir dinámicamente generar algún componente u otro, o solo una parte de JSX, en función de condicionales. Cómo generar
programar
es
https://aprendeprogramando.es/static/images/programar-representacion-condicional-en-react-1882-0.jpg
2025-01-17

Si crees que alguno de los contenidos (texto, imagenes o multimedia) en esta página infringe tus derechos relativos a propiedad intelectual, marcas registradas o cualquier otro de tus derechos, por favor ponte en contacto con nosotros en el mail [email protected] y retiraremos este contenido inmediatamente